You should complete a non-degree student application if you are:
- A transient or visiting student from another college who wishes to take a few courses but will graduate from your 4-year "home" college. You must submit written transient permission for those courses from your "home" college advisor, dean, or registrar. If your college or university does not have their own transient approval form, use the UofSC Visiting / Transient Student Approval form. We will not process any transient/visiting application without written approval from your “home” institution.
- A college graduate needing additional credits to qualify for admission to a graduate or professional school. You must supply proof of your degree by submitting an official transcript showing degree and date awarded. Please note that a diploma (or copy of a diploma) is considered a ceremonial document and cannot be used for admission purposes.
- A senior citizen taking one or more classes for personal enrichment via tuition waiver.
Is financial aid or housing available?
Non-degree students are not eligible for financial aid or veterans' benefits. In addition, campus housing is generally not available, except during summer terms. An exception is made for International Student Exchange students who are housed on campus during the regular terms.
I am active-duty military. Can I take classes?
Men and women on active duty with the armed forces who do not plan to work toward a degree at this time may be admitted to the university as non-degree military special students. Active duty orders are required to certify active duty status.
Active duty military personnel may also choose to apply to the USC Fort Jackson Military Associate Program using the appropriate online degree-seeking application. In addition, all military students (regardless of active duty status) are welcome to apply to a bachelor's degree program using one of the university's standard degree-seeking applications for admission (standard application fees and requirements apply.)
Please note transfer credit for military students will be evaluated only for those students accepted as traditional degree-seeking students.
The application fee is waived for active duty military personnel applying for the non-degree military special program or the USC Fort Jackson Military Associate Program.

What is the application fee?
A nonrefundable fee of $25 is required with this application. International students must pay a nonrefundable application fee of $100. The application fee is waived for active duty military personnel applying for the non-degree military special program.
Please note:
- Students who do not meet Columbia degree-seeking admission requirements may not be eligible for non-degree admission.
- Transient permission from the "home" institution must be granted for all transient (visiting) applicants. However, transient permission from the home institution does not imply or guarantee admission into the University of South Carolina.
- The Office of Undergraduate Admissions determines the appropriate credentials required in order to consider your application for admission. When necessary, we may ask for additional transcripts in order to assess your admissibility, academic preparation, and potential for success as a UofSC student.
- All non-degree students are admitted on a space-available basis and register for available courses after currently enrolled UofSC degree-seeking students. In some cases permission of the department of instruction may be required.
- The University of South Carolina will only accept an official transcript showing degree and date awarded as proof of degree.
